Bhuj Airport

Welcome to Bhuj Airport, your gateway to the beautiful Kutch District in Gujarat, India. As one of the domestic airports in Bhuj, Bhuj Airport serves as a crucial hub for both military and public operations. Operated by the Indian Air Force and the Airports Authority of India, this airport offers convenient connectivity to various destinations, including direct flights to Mumbai.

Located just 4 kilometers from Bhuj, Bhuj Airport boasts a single terminal capable of handling up to 350 passengers at a time. With its well-equipped facilities and efficient services, this airport ensures a hassle-free travel experience for both arrivals and departures.

Location and Coordinates

Bhuj Airport is conveniently located in Bhuj, in the Kutch district of Gujarat, India. Situated at a latitude of 23°17’16″N and a longitude of 69°40’13″E, the airport is easily accessible to travelers from various parts of the country.

Infrastructure and Facilities

Bhuj Airport offers a range of infrastructure and facilities to ensure a convenient and comfortable travel experience for passengers. The airport has a single terminal with a total area of 71,920 square feet on the ground floor and 14,880 square feet on the first floor. It features two boarding gates, four check-in counters, and one security counter.

With a capacity to accommodate up to 200 people arriving and 200 people departing at a time, Bhuj Airport strives to provide efficient service to its passengers. The terminal is equipped with X-ray baggage scanning facilities, ensuring the safety and security of all travelers.

For the convenience of passengers, the airport offers free trolleys and wheelchair services. Travelers can also find a variety of shops selling magazines, newspapers, and medicines, catering to their diverse needs during their time at the airport. Additionally, there is a snack bar available, providing refreshments and snacks for those in need of a quick bite.

Runway and Runway Statistics

Bhuj Airport Runway

Bhuj Airport features a single runway, oriented towards 05/23, with a length of 8,205 feet (2,501 meters). The runway surface is made of asphalt, ensuring a smooth and secure landing and takeoff for aircraft. With its adequate length, the runway can accommodate a variety of aircraft types, including commercial and military planes.

According to statistics from April 2022 to March 2023, Bhuj Airport experienced a total of 1,191 aircraft movements during this period. These movements include both arrivals and departures, showcasing the significant air traffic at this regional airport. Additionally, the airport served a total of 45,755 passengers, highlighting its importance as a key transportation hub in the Kutch District of Gujarat.

History and Renovation

Bhuj Airport has a significant historical background. During the Indo-Pakistani War of 1971, the airport suffered extensive damage from air strikes. However, in a remarkable display of resilience and determination, a group of 300 women from the nearby village of Madhapar came together to rebuild the airport within a remarkable timeframe of just 72 hours. Their efforts not only restored the airport’s infrastructure but also symbolized the unwavering spirit of the local community.

Unfortunately, in 2001, Bhuj Airport was once again subjected to destruction, this time in the form of a devastating earthquake. The airport underwent extensive renovation, costing approximately INR 400 million, and was reopened to the public in 2003. The refurbishment aimed to enhance and modernize the facility, ensuring it could cater to the growing demands of air travel while providing a safe and comfortable experience for passengers.

Bhuj Airport Transport Options

When traveling to and from Bhuj Airport, passengers have a variety of convenient transport options to choose from. The airport provides general taxi services, allowing passengers to easily reach their desired destinations. Additionally, most hotels in the area offer pick-up services from the airport, ensuring a hassle-free journey for travelers.

If you prefer public transportation, state transport buses operate from the nearby bus stand, which is only 4 kilometers away from the airport. These buses provide a cost-effective option for reaching various locations within Bhuj and the surrounding areas.

In addition to taxis and buses, private taxi services are also available, offering a more personalized and comfortable mode of transportation. These taxis can take you directly to your desired location, making it a convenient choice for travelers with specific destinations in mind.

Furthermore, the airport is well-connected with the railway station, which is located 3.4 kilometers away. Both private taxis and state buses are readily available to transport passengers between the airport and the railway station, ensuring seamless connectivity for those traveling by train.

Aina Mahal

Aina Mahal, also known as the “Palace of Mirrors,” is a stunning palace in Bhuj that showcases exquisite craftsmanship and intricate design. Built in the 18th century, it is renowned for its elaborate mirror work, exquisite Venetian chandeliers, and European-style paintings.

Pragmahel Palace

Pragmahel Palace is another architectural marvel located near Bhuj Airport. This historic palace was built by Maharao Pragmalji II in the 19th century and served as the royal residence. Today, it houses the Kutch Museum, which displays a vast collection of artifacts, textiles, and archaeological findings.

Kutch Museum

The Kutch Museum is a must-visit for history and art enthusiasts. It is the oldest museum in Gujarat and houses a diverse collection of artifacts that depict the rich cultural heritage of the Kutch district. Visitors can explore exhibits showcasing traditional textiles, silverware, historical relics, and folk art.
